Pacific Traditions Gallery proudly presents “Landscapes and Textiles”
by the renown landscape designer, artist and author Stephen Haus


A retrospective of garden designs, and textile featuring performances by the Shakti Dancers, in costumes by the artist. “The source of my work is the natural world, the found object, butterfly wings, the colors of fish, and the beauty of Hawaii nei”.

Stephen Haus has designed gardens, in the tropical zone, around the world. His work has been featured in Architectural Digest, and on Martha Stewart and House and Garden Television. He has received the Rome Prize in Landscape Architecture, and was a Henry Luce Scholar in Kyoto, Japan.

The textile designs of Stephen Haus have been shown at “The Artists of Hawaii”
Exhibition at the Academy of Arts, featured on Austrian National Television, and sold at Nieman Marcus.


Stephen Christopher Haus will be available to autograph his book “Gardens of Hawaii.

The book has large, beautiful color photos with succinct text. Includes photos of Honolulu Academy of Arts, Lyon Arboretum, Four Season Grand Wailea, Punchbowl, Mauna Kea Resort, Pacific Tropical Botanical Garden, and several private residences, including author's own garden and that of his mentor, May Moir. “Gardens of Hawaii” makes great Christmas presents.
